Do You Meet the Prerequisites for Accredited Electrician Schools?

There are some requirements that have to be met before one can be an electrical technology professional.

  • Provide proof that you have completed a minimum of one semester of algebra
  • Be a minimum of 18 years old
  • Have a high school diploma or GED

Some Reasons Why Your Electrician License is Crucial for You

The State of Iowa requires electricians operating inside its borders to be certified. There is good reason for this to be the situation. Several of the major ones are highlighted below.

  • Owning a current certification is required to operate legally in Iowa
  • Ensuring that electrical contractors remain licensed protects the trust of the public and business owners
  • Many electrical codes change regularly and licensure guarantees that electrical industry professionals are kept abreast of these changes

Electrician Classes – What to Look For

There are specific matters you must consider when you are ready to choose between electrician schools. You might hear that electrician programs are all similar, however there are certain things you should really be aware of before selecting which electrician trade schools to register for in Bedford IA. When you begin taking a look at schools, you will have to see if the program has the appropriate qualifications with a well-known organization like the Iowa licensing board. A number of other topics you will want to consider other than the accreditation status include:

  • Look for classes with a program that will meet Iowa certification requirements
  • Make certain the institution trains with equipment that fits current field standards
  • Determine if the school gives financial aid
  • Make sure the school’s curriculum offers an apprentice program
